Security Clearance: Active Top Secret / SCI required About the Role We are seeking an experienced Senior Systems Engineer to support newly awarded programs focused on High Assurance Device (HAD) development and certification. This role plays a key part in system requirements, architecture, verification, and government technical reviews for secure, mission-critical technologies. The ideal candidate will operate confidently in classified environments and support program execution throughout the full lifecycle. Key Responsibilities Lead development and management of system requirements for High Assurance Devices. Establish and maintain requirements traceability, verification, and validation. Develop test methodologies to verify system requirements. Prepare and support major technical reviews (SRR, PDR, CDR, etc.) in accordance with government CDRLs/DIDs. Guide system architecture and trade studies for: Encryption devices Key management systems FPGAs and ASICs Identify technical risks and define mitigation strategies. Support formal government certification processes for HAD systems. Required Qualifications Bachelor’s degree in Systems Engineering or a related engineering discipline. 10 years of experience in systems engineering, program execution, and DoD acquisition processes. Demonstrated ability to work within classified environments. Strong communication and documentation skills. Active TS/SCI clearance required. Desired Skills Experience working with High Assurance Devices. Familiarity with cryptologic networking standards (e.g., MACsec, IPsec). Background in software, hardware, FPGA, or ASIC development.
